More recoveries have been reported in the region.
Public Health Sudbury and Districts now shows 88 of its 92 reported cases are considered "resolved" - including two deaths reported previously - leaving only four "active", including one reported in Greater Sudbury over the weekend.
The Thunder Bay District Health Unit's now reporting all 100 cases it has reported are resolved - including one reported in the Thunder Bay area earlier this week - though that does include a death reported previously.
The neighbouring Porcupine Health Unit still has one active case, while Algoma Public Health hasn't had one in more than two weeks, though it's waiting on results from 678 tests.
